Filtering Out Separate Motions from a MotionPlus File
MotionPlus files contain actor and accessory-related animations. When you want to re-use them, you can reuse and combine animations to a group of actors, or choose to separate and apply different parts of the animation.
Merging Data from Different MotionPlus File
-
Here we have two actors; one is sitting and talking.
The other one is running but mute. -
Export the first actor's entire motion range (body motions, voices and facial expressions) as a MotionPlus file.
Please refer to the Body Motion and Facial Expressions section for more information. - Select the second actor (in this case, the chimpanzee).
-
Click the File >> Merge MotionPlus command from the main menu bar.
Select the MotionPlus file exported in the previous step.
-
You will be prompted with the filter dialogue box below. Activate the Facial
Animation box to ensure that only the voice, lip-synching keys and the
facial expressions in the MotionPlus are extracted and applied to
the actor.
-
You will see that only the first actor's facial animations are applied to
the actor while the original body motions are kept.
